Vieux Lyon: For Lovers of History and Charm
Vieux Lyon, a UNESCO World Heritage site, is renowned for its Renaissance architecture, narrow cobblestone streets, and quaint charm. Its traboules, or covered passageways, link buildings and add to its allure. This district is a history lover’s paradise, with locations such as the Cathédrale Saint-Jean and numerous museums, offering a peek into Lyon’s rich past.
While wandering Vieux Lyon, you’re treated to a vibrant atmosphere filled with street performers, artisanal shops, and traditional bouchon restaurants. Dining in one of these Lyonnais eateries gives you a taste of local culinary traditions, making it a must-do for food enthusiasts. However, the allure of historical beauty comes with practicality catches – the area is hilly and involves a good amount of walking.
Choosing a place to stay in this area offers various options. Luxury seekers might check into Villa Florentine, a lavish hotel boasting stunning views from its hillside terrace. For a unique experience in restored Renaissance buildings, Cour des Loges offers a captivating blend of history and comfort, complemented by a spa and Michelin-starred restaurant.

For mid-range accommodation, Collège Hôtel’s school-themed décor is quirky yet elegant, making stays both affordable and delightful. If you’re traveling on a budget, Bienvenue Chez Sylvie provides comfortable guesthouse living with a personal touch.

Presqu’Ile: The Heart of Lyon for First-time Visitors
The Presqu’Ile is arguably the beating heart of Lyon, stretching between two rivers – the Rhône and the Saône. It’s where you’ll find a hub of shopping, dining, and cultural spots. This central area is ideal for first-timers who wish to be at the core of all activities. Expect bustling marketplaces, expansive squares like Place Bellecour, and notable sights like the Opéra Nouvel and Hôtel de Ville.
This district boasts a broad spectrum of accommodations. For a touch of luxury, the Sofitel Lyon Bellecour offers elegant rooms with breathtaking river views and top-tier services. MiHotel in Presqu’Ile caters to those who fancy high-tech, design-oriented stays, offering contactless check-in with a boutique flair.
Visitors can consider mid-range options like Globe et Cecil Hôtel, seamlessly blending classic décor with modern comforts. Its location near Place Bellecour is perfect for those wanting convenience and proximity to major sites. Budget travelers will find Hotel du Théâtre appealing, offering a clean and basic base just a stone’s throw from the hustle and bustle of the city.

Fourvière: For Peace and Stunning Views
Perched above the city, Fourvière is known for its serene atmosphere and panoramic views of Lyon. Home to the breathtaking Basilica of Notre-Dame, this area serves as a tranquil retreat for families and those seeking a break from the urban rush. Visitors to Fourvière can explore Roman-era theaters and stroll through Parc des Hauteurs for both history and nature.
The accommodation scene in Fourvière caters to those who prefer peace and style. Fourvière Hôtel Lyon, once a convent, offers a harmonious blend of historical setting and modern comforts, with a spa and garden to unwind in tranquility. Mid-range seekers will find Hotel Saphir appealing with its proximity to transportation and quiet environment, ideal for restful stays.
On a budget? Little Italy – Studio fourvière presents a self-sufficient stay near the Saône, ideal for solo travelers or couples. If you’re staying longer, Le Trion offers apartment-style accommodation, perfect for experiencing Lyon like a local.

Pentes de la Croix-Rousse: A Haven for Food and Culture Enthusiasts
Known for its creative, artistic vibe, the slopes of Croix-Rousse offer a unique blend of history and contemporary culture. Here, artisan bakeries, cozy cafés, and bustling markets give off a lively community atmosphere. This neighborhood is cherished for its hidden traboules and vibrant street art that adorns the hilly, picturesque streets.
Accommodation choices here range from boutique stays to budget-friendly hostels. Maison Nô provides a chic, modern stay complete with a rooftop view, perfect for travelers who treasure contemporary design and comfort. The Hotel Fort St Laurent Lyon offers a quiet, upscale retreat, making it an ideal choice for those seeking solace and romance.
For mid-range options, consider the Grand Hotel Des Terreaux, combining traditional French ambiance with excellent location. Budget-conscious explorers can opt for Pilo Lyon, a hostel offering community-oriented lodging that fosters social interactions.

Confluence: For Modern Luxury and Urban Style
Confluence stands as a testament to Lyon’s forward-looking architecture and urban planning. Known for its modern aesthetic and eco-friendly design, this area also offers green spaces along the Saône River. Perfect for travelers who appreciate contemporary design and open spaces, Confluence is filled with trendy eateries, shopping centers, and fascinating museums.
In terms of facilities, accommodation in Confluence is particularly esteemed for its modern style and high standards. Keystone Hôtel & Spa provides luxury seekers with a soothing stay, complete with spa indulgences. Novotel Lyon Centre Confluence offers a family-friendly experience, boasting spacious rooms and easy access to shopping and trams.
